MIDDLETON Engineering are proud to introduce Britain's first One-Stop Solution to Bale, String-Tie and Wrap your RDF/SRF. We have developed our popular HB60 Pre-Press Baler range to produce a cost-effective String-Tie Baler.
When baling and strapping solid waste for incineration purposes, the traditional steel wire must be removed before the incineration process begins, which of course costs both time and money. Middleton Engineering’s polypropylene system offers significant reduction in both, as well as a reduction in consumables costs.
In conjunction with our new Wrapper system, you can now produce a tightly-wrapped bale that can be easily stored and transported - overseas if necessary.

String Tie and Wrap RDF
One of the main advantages of tying your bales with Polypropylene Twine is the significant reduction in running costs.
At today's prices, the average bale costs almost £2.00 to tie using Black Annealed Mild Steel Baling Wire.
Now compare that with just £0.30 per bale using Polypropylene Twine.
The Polypropylene Twine is also superior when baling recyclable plastics and Refuse-Derived Fuels.
High-quality material can quickly deteriorate in contact with rusting steel wire, especially if the bales are stored outdoors, or the product is particularly high in moisture content.
The Polypropylene Twine breaking properties are comparable to the steel wire, too.
